Lab Technician
AB Mauri North America is a company focused on yeast products, and they are seeking a Lab Technician to operate laboratory equipment, conduct quality control tests, and maintain compliance with safety standards. The role involves preparing chemical solutions, testing materials for quality, and supporting food safety initiatives.

Responsibilities
Set up, adjust and operate laboratory equipment and instruments such as microscopes, centrifuge, agitators, scales, Activigraph, nitrogen analyzer, spectrophotometer, and other lab equipment
Prepare chemical solutions according to standard formulas
Participate in trouble shooting processes and provides analytical information and technical support as needed for Fermentation, Production and Supply Chain
Test materials used as ingredients in yeast products for such qualities as purity, stability, viscosity, density, absorption, brix, and melting or flash point
Test solutions used in processes for chemical concentration, specific gravity, pH, brix or other characteristics
Test materials for presence and content of elements or substances such as hydrocarbons, manganese, sulfur, ash, dust, or impurities
Test samples of manufactured yeast products to verify conformity to specifications
Responsible for HACCP verification activities
Respond and react to the detection of testing anomalies and deviations in operation or procedure (performing instrument and method troubleshooting, initiating laboratory-based investigations)
Collect samples for analytical testing of effluent treatment
Responsible for microbiological data analysis and monitoring of plant process water for EPA compliance
Complies with SQF and corporate standards
Product release according to specifications
Support Food Safety Culture
Record test results on standardized forms and writes test reports describing procedures used
Prepare graphs and charts
Review data and generate statistical reports including graphs and charts
Clean and sterilize laboratory equipment
Calibrate laboratory instruments and perform preventive maintenance as scheduled
Complete assigned duties on Master Sanitation Schedule
